On Tuesday, January 27, Rajasthan Lions and Maharashtra Tycoons will square off in Match 3 of the World Legends Pro T20 League 2026 at the 1919 Sportz Cricket Stadium in Goa. The Lions' seasoned team, which includes Suresh Raina, Ben Cutting, Naman Ojha, Jean-Paul Duminy, and Abhimanyu Mithun, is led by former England captain Eoin Morgan. Rajasthan will be eager to establish its dominance and make a statement early in the tournament thanks to a solid foundation of seasoned international cricket players and accomplished all-rounders.
Under Dinesh Karthik's leadership, the Maharashtra Tycoons, on the other hand, have a formidable team that can quickly alter games. The Tycoons have depth in both batting and bowling thanks to the participation of international superstars like Chris Gayle, Shaun Marsh, Dale Steyn, Carlos Brathwaite, and Stuart Binny. With their abundance of explosive skill and big-match experience, Maharashtra will be keen to challenge Rajasthan's well-balanced setup and begin their season on a winning note.

1919 Sportz Cricket Stadium Pitch Report:
In general, bowling is favoured at the 1919 Sportz Cricket Stadium. Dew may play a role later in the evening because the game is being played at night, which might make things challenging for the bowlers. Because flatter deliveries tend to land on the bat more easily in these circumstances, spinners will need to alter their tempo and give the ball some air.
